Comprehending White Copy Paper
White copy paper generally includes a smooth finish and is typically made from cellulose fibers. The most typical type of white paper used in printers and photo copiers is referred to as "bond paper," which is valued for its ink compatibility and adaptability.

Picking the appropriate white copy paper can significantly impact the quality of printed materials. Here are some best practices:
1. Identify Your Needs
What is the function of the document? If you're printing expert documents, think about utilizing premium copy paper that boosts the overall discussion. For daily printing, standard copy paper is sufficient.
2. Inspect Printer Compatibility
Before buying, inspect the specifications of your A4 Printer Paper. Some printers carry out better with specific weights and finishes. Utilizing the suggested paper can prevent jams and misprints.
3. Think About Environmental Impact
Go with recycled paper whenever possible. Lots of brands now provide top quality recycled choices that are eco-friendly without compromising on print quality.
4. Test Samples
If you're unsure which paper type to pick, demand samples from suppliers. Testing various weights and surfaces can help you make an educated choice about what works best for your requirements.
5. Shop Properly
To protect the quality of your paper, store it in a cool, dry location. Humidity can trigger paper to warp or end up being brittle, affecting print performance.
